In the digital age, political campaigns are leveraging advanced marketing tools to reach voters effectively and optimize outreach. Here's a glimpse into some of the most transformative technologies shaping today's political landscape.

## Advanced Tools for Targeted Campaigns

1. **Voter Data Analysis Software**: Tools like eCanvasser and Filpac enable campaigns to analyse voter demographics and behaviour, targeting key segments more accurately. This data-driven approach ensures resources are allocated efficiently, maximising outreach and engagement.

2. **Campaign Management Platforms**: Platforms such as Campaign Planner offer features like campaign analysis, contact management, contribution tracking, and donor targeting, streamlining campaign processes and enhancing strategic planning.

3. **Social Media and Digital PR Platforms**: Integrating digital PR strategies, including social media, email marketing, and mobile optimization, allows campaigns to engage with voters dynamically and respond to emerging trends in real-time.

4. **CTV and Online Advertising**: Connected TV (CTV) and online advertising platforms enable campaigns to reach targeted audiences with precision, amplifying their reach and efficacy.

## Other Key Tools

1. **Event Management Tools**: Eventbrite and Mobilize help coordinate rallies, town halls, and community meet-ups while collecting attendee data for future outreach.

2. **Grassroots Mobilization Tools**: Mobilize, Outvote, and CallHub are designed for grassroots mobilization, organising volunteers, planning events, and managing door-to-door or peer-to-peer outreach.

3. **Fundraising Tools**: ActBlue, WinRed, and NationBuilder are widely used for political fundraising through online donations and donor management.

4. **Communication Tools**: Email marketing platforms, predictive dialers, and text messaging services allow campaigns to send targeted updates, fundraising appeals, and personalised content directly to voters.

5. **Creative Tools**: Canva, Adobe Express, and Lumen5 help create professional-quality visuals, videos, and infographics for multi-channel use.

6. **Social Listening and Media Monitoring Tools**: Hootsuite, Meltwater, and Mention help track competitor messaging and trends across digital platforms.
